All Products

Sort by:
... 85
SKU: DS223/12TB-REDPLUS
  ETA 10 days
SKU: DS223/12TB-IW
28   In Stock
SKU: DS1621+/72TB-HAT33
  ETA 10 days
SKU: DS1621+/48TB-HAT33
  ETA 10 days
SKU: DS1621+/36TB-HAT33
  ETA 10 days
SKU: DS1621+/24TB-HAT33
  ETA 10 days
SKU: DS124/8TB-HAT33
  ETA 10 days
SKU: DS124/6TB-HAT33
9   In Stock
SKU: DS124/4TB-HAT33
  ETA 10 days
SKU: DS124/12TB-HAT33
  ETA 10 days
SKU: DS124
  ETA 10 days
SKU: 218-DISKLESS-EU
  ETA 10 days
SKU: TS-I410X-8G
  ETA 10 days
SKU: DS620SLIM
  ETA 10 days
SKU: TS-H1277AFX-R7-32G
  ETA 10 days
... 85
Add to cart